If x=y=2z and xyz=256 then what is the value of x?

  1. 12

  2. 6

  3. 8

  4. 16


Correct Option: C
Explanation:

To find the value of x, we can use the given information.

We are given that x = y = 2z and xyz = 256.

Since x = y, we can substitute x with y in the second equation:

xy * z = 256

(x * x) * z = 256

x^2 * z = 256

Now, we know that x = 2z, so we can substitute x in terms of z:

(2z)^2 * z = 256

4z^2 * z = 256

4z^3 = 256

To solve for z, we can divide both sides of the equation by 4:

z^3 = 64

Taking the cube root of both sides gives us:

z = 4

Now that we know the value of z, we can substitute it back into the equation x = y = 2z:

x = y = 2 * 4

x = y = 8

Therefore, the value of x is 8.

The answer is: C. 8
